'01 SS with stubborn dtc U1040
Hello everyone!
I've run into some issues with a customers car that I just can't seem to understand why the EBCM unit won't communicate..
Its a '01 SS with LS1 and traction control.
It started with one single fault code EBCM C0550 - internal malfunction. So I ordered a used EBCM of a scrapyard with the same P/N and installed it, now it's the first time it throws SRS U1040 - No communication with EBCM.
So I started to check all the wiring to see if i've been wrong with just replacing the EBCM.. BUT:
- Ground OK
- Power Supply OK
- Class 2 wire measured 0.3 ohms between splicepack and EBCM connector
- Removed the comb in the splicepack and did a wire bypass to see if any other module brought the EBCM down, but all the other modules EXCEPT the EBCM communicates..
So I ordered 2 used units and sent them to UpFix to have them serviced / repaired just to be 100% sure it would fix the problem.
Units arrived, installed them, fault still pressent ..
What am I missing / doing wrong ?
